March 2010 Women's History Month Theme: Writing Women Back into History

2010 will be the 30th anniversary of the National Women’s History Project. The Project began the mobilizing the lobbying effort that resulted in President Carter issuing a Presidential Proclamation declaring the week of March 8, 1980 as the first National Women’s History Week. In 1987, another lobbying effort resulted in Congress expanding the week into a month, and March is now National Women’s History Month. The overarching theme for 2010 and the Project's 30th Anniversary celebration is Writing Women Back into History.
